Job Summary:

The senior corporate counsel will play a critical role in handling matters on all aspects of the corporate team, but primarily around international subsidiary management and corporate expansion, treasury, state and blue sky compliance and management, international board and governance, equity administration and support, and other general corporate transactions. This person will also oversee the work of the corporate paralegal and be responsible for cross functional partnership on various matters. 

The Senior Corporate Counsel will manage and support the following matters:

● Support the Company’s legal maintenance for all subsidiaries.

● Manage and oversee state compliance and blue sky matters.

● Assists with cross-functional international expansion efforts, including entity creation and maintenance.

● Manage international board and governance matters for the Company’s subsidiaries.

● Manage and assist with stock administration equity plan creation and management in the U.S. and in international jurisdictions.

● Support corporate governance efforts, including Board and Committee matters.

● Support financial reporting obligations for the Company’s subsidiaries.

● Support general equity matters, including stockholder inquiries, requests from preferred investors, and cap table management.

● Support various corporate and financial transactions.

● Provide legal support over internal corporate policies and trainings.

● Provide legal support over Treasury and IR functions.

Basic Qualifications:

  • J.D. from an accredited U.S. law school, admission to practice law in a U.S. state (California preferred), and at least 6 years of combined relevant experience in law firms, governmental agencies, and/or in-house legal departments. In-house experience is preferred.

  • Must have relevant general corporate and securities experience.
